Introduction: Malungaje : toward a poetics of diaspora -- Dislocation and re/membering : Ndongo and D'guiar write the middle passage -- Dislocation and double consciousness in Kamau Brathwaite : the poet as guinea-bird -- Speaking truth, speaking power : of "immigrants," immanence, and Linton Kwesi Johnson's "Street 66" -- Exile's half-life, exile's dead end : the conundrum of location in Equatoguinean literature -- Marcando territorio (marking territory) : location as project and process in Colombia.
